Popular Rail Routes from London to Italy
Several rail routes connect London to Italy, each with its own charm and advantages. The most common route involves taking the Eurostar from London to Paris, then transferring to a high-speed train such as the TGV or Frecciarossa to reach Italian cities like Milan, Venice, or Rome. Another scenic option includes traveling through Switzerland, with stops in Zurich or Geneva before descending into Italy via the Alps.
High-Speed Rail Options
High-speed trains like Italy’s Frecciarossa and France’s TGV offer quick and comfortable travel between major cities. These trains feature spacious seating, onboard dining, and Wi-Fi, ensuring a pleasant journey. For example, the Frecciarossa can reach speeds of up to 186 mph, making it possible to travel from Paris to Milan in just under 7 hours.
Scenic Rail Journeys
For those who prefer a slower, more scenic route, options like the Bernina Express in Switzerland provide breathtaking views of the Alps before crossing into Italy. These journeys are ideal for travelers who want to savor the landscape and enjoy a more leisurely pace.
All-Inclusive Package Options
All-inclusive rail holiday packages vary widely, catering to different budgets and preferences. Some packages focus on luxury, offering first-class rail travel, stays in 4- or 5-star hotels, and exclusive guided tours. Others provide more affordable options with standard rail seating and mid-range accommodations. Many packages also include city passes or skip-the-line tickets to popular attractions, adding value and convenience.
Luxury Packages
Luxury packages often feature private cabins, gourmet meals, and stays in boutique hotels. Companies like Railbookers and Great Rail Journeys specialize in high-end rail vacations, with itineraries that include wine tastings, private tours, and unique cultural experiences.
Budget-Friendly Packages
Budget-conscious travelers can find affordable packages through operators like Trainline or Eurail, which offer flexible rail passes and discounted accommodations. These packages are ideal for those who want to explore Italy without breaking the bank.

Tips for Booking Your Rail Vacation
Booking early is key to securing the best deals, especially for peak travel seasons like summer and Christmas. Consider traveling during shoulder seasons (spring or fall) for lower prices and fewer crowds. Research the specific rail passes or packages that best suit your itinerary, and don’t hesitate to consult travel agents or online resources for personalized recommendations.
